Sewer Line Camera Service in Cumming, GA
Sewer line camera services involve the use of specialized, high-resolution cameras to inspect underground sewer lines and pipes. This process allows homeowners to identify issues such as blockages, tree root intrusion, cracks, or collapsed pipes without invasive digging. These inspections are useful for diagnosing problems in both residential and commercial properties, especially when experiencing persistent clogs, foul odors, or backup issues. Property owners typically request this service to understand the condition of their sewer system, determine the cause of recurring problems, or assess the need for repairs or replacements.
Before requesting a sewer line camera inspection, property owners should consider the history of their plumbing system and any recent symptoms indicating a potential problem. It is helpful to know the location of main sewer access points and whether there have been previous repairs or issues in the area. Clear information about the property's plumbing layout and the specific concerns can assist in planning the inspection effectively. This service provides a detailed view of the underground pipes, helping property owners make informed decisions about necessary repairs or maintenance.

Common Sewer Line Camera Service Jobs
Sewer line inspection - identify blockages, cracks, or damage within underground sewer lines.
Clog detection - locate the source of persistent or recurring sewer backups.
Pipe condition assessment - evaluate the integrity of aging or deteriorating sewer pipes.
Drain line troubleshooting - diagnose issues causing slow drains or foul odors.
Pre-repair inspections - verify pipe conditions before sewer line repairs or replacements.
Post-repair evaluation - confirm proper function after sewer line repairs are completed.
Sewer Line Camera Service Questions
What is sewer line camera service? It involves using a specialized camera to inspect underground sewer pipes for blockages, damage, or obstructions.
When should property owners consider sewer line camera inspections? These inspections are useful when experiencing persistent drain backups, foul odors, or after noticing slow drainage.
How does sewer line camera service help with repairs? The camera provides a clear view of pipe conditions, helping identify issues that require targeted repairs or replacements.
Is sewer line camera service invasive? No, it is a non-invasive method that allows for thorough inspection without digging or extensive disruption.
